Felt Studios Cute Illustrated Best Buzzies Card Ecard

Product description

Front of cardCute Illustration of two bees face to face on a green background photo upload card. Text reads : "Best Buzzies!"Back of card : Felt Studios logo. logo. | Felt Studios Cute Illustrated Best Buzzies Card Ecard

Top